Busser
The busser is responsible for assisting wait staff and bartenders with upkeep of tables and service areas. When a party departs, a busser removes dirty dishes, sanitizes the table, cleans the seats and tidies up the surrounding floor/table area.

Barcelona Wine Bar is a warm and welcoming tapas bar inspired by the culture of Spain. The ever-changing menu is focused on clean flavors, seasonal ingredients, specialties from Spain and the Mediterranean, and rustic small plate presentations created by chefs with tremendous talent. Barcelona offers an award-winning selection of wines from Spain and South Americaand boasts as one of the largest Spanish wine programs in the U.S. Established in CT in 1996, there are now restaurants in Connecticut, Georgia, Massachusetts, Tennesse, Philadelphia, Virginia, and Washington D.C.
